Bunyan D. Davis, age 90, of Cedartown Highway, Rockmart, passed away
Wednesday, March 5, in a Rome hospital. Mr. Davis was born February 17,
1907, in Polk County. He was the retired owner and operator of Davis Grocery
Store, a former Polk County school bus driver, and a member of Bethlehem
Baptist Church. He was preceded in death by his wife, Clora Harris Davis,
and parents, Dorsey and Delia Davis. Surviving are; son, Aubra Davis of
Rome; two grandchildren, Scott Davis and Shelia Ray, both of Rome; and a
great grandson. Funeral services were held Saturday, March 8, at 2 p.m. from
the Freeman Harris Funeral Home Chapel, with Rev. Frank Rayburn and Rev.
Royce Campbell officiating. Burial followed in Polk Memory Gardens, Serving
as pallbearers were: Delmer Rayburn, Joe Rayburn, Doug Rayburn, J.C.
Rayburn, Randy Rayburn, and Charles Hopkins. The Freeman Harris Funeral Home
had charge of the arrangements. (The Cedartown Standard, Cedartown, Ga,
Tuesday, March 11, 1997)
